Southeast Missouri vs Arkansas State College Football Week 1 – Aug 30, 2025
The 2025 College Football season kicks off with an intriguing Week 1 matchup between the Southeast Missouri Redhawks and the Arkansas State Red Wolves on Saturday, August 30, at 6:00 PM. The game will take place at Centennial Bank Stadium in Jonesboro, Arkansas, offering fans an early-season clash filled with energy, intensity, and high expectations. Southeast Missouri Redhawks: Season Outlook and Key Players
The Southeast Missouri Redhawks, led by Head Coach Tom Matukewicz, enter the 2025 season looking to build upon their reputation as a resilient and disciplined program. Known for their grit and ability to battle against bigger programs, the Redhawks will aim to make a statement against Arkansas State in this season opener.
Quarterback Carter Davis leads the offense, bringing both composure and playmaking ability to the Redhawks’ scheme. Davis is capable of making accurate throws under pressure and extending plays with his legs when necessary. His chemistry with wide receivers Jeremiah Banks and Trey Washington will be crucial in creating explosive plays and keeping Arkansas State’s defense on its toes.
The Redhawks’ ground game is anchored by running back Zach Smith, a powerful runner with a knack for finding gaps and breaking tackles. Smith’s ability to control the tempo and sustain drives will be essential for Southeast Missouri’s offensive rhythm. Supporting the attack is an offensive line led by Daniel Morgan, who provides stability and protection against aggressive defensive fronts.
On defense, Southeast Missouri relies heavily on linebacker Jordan Harris and defensive back Marcus Lee. Harris is a tackling machine, capable of shutting down rushing attacks, while Lee’s ball-hawking skills in the secondary give the Redhawks a chance to create turnovers. Their defensive scheme emphasizes pressure and opportunism, aiming to disrupt Arkansas State’s offensive flow.
Arkansas State Red Wolves: Strengths and Star Players
The Arkansas State Red Wolves, coached by Butch Jones, enter 2025 with the goal of reasserting themselves as a powerhouse within the Sun Belt Conference. Playing at home in Centennial Bank Stadium gives them a clear edge, as their fan base creates one of the most energetic atmospheres in the conference.
Quarterback Ethan Foster is the centerpiece of the Red Wolves’ offense. With his strong arm and ability to read defenses, Foster excels at pushing the ball downfield and capitalizing on mismatches. His primary targets, wide receivers Malik Brown and Devon Carter, provide speed and physicality, making them difficult to contain for opposing defenses.
Arkansas State’s rushing attack, led by running back Jaden White, adds balance to their offense. White is known for his quick bursts and agility, allowing him to turn routine plays into big gains. The offensive line, anchored by Cole Thompson, plays a pivotal role in providing Foster time to execute and creating space for White’s runs.
On the defensive side, the Red Wolves feature standout linebacker Xavier Mitchell and defensive back Chris Reynolds. Mitchell brings leadership and physicality to the front seven, while Reynolds is a proven playmaker in the secondary. Together, they embody a defensive strategy focused on aggressive pursuit, tackling efficiency, and creating turnovers.
Head-to-Head Matchup Analysis
This game pits the Redhawks’ resilience against the Red Wolves’ explosiveness. Southeast Missouri thrives on discipline, clock management, and physical play, while Arkansas State leans on a high-powered offense and an opportunistic defense.
The Redhawks’ best chance lies in controlling time of possession with their rushing attack and limiting Arkansas State’s opportunities for explosive plays. Quarterback Carter Davis will need to avoid turnovers and sustain drives, while Zach Smith must establish himself early in the run game. Defensively, containing Ethan Foster and limiting big plays from Brown and Carter will be crucial.
Arkansas State, on the other hand, will look to exploit Southeast Missouri’s secondary with their aerial attack. If Foster can connect on deep passes and White can add consistency in the running game, the Red Wolves will be difficult to stop. Their defense will aim to pressure Davis and force him into hurried decisions, creating opportunities for turnovers.
Special teams could also play a pivotal role in this matchup, as field position and timely kicks may swing momentum in what could be a competitive contest.
